Here I show my chart for converting model railway speeds to scale speeds. You may pause the video to read the times. This is for 00 Gauge - 1/76th scale.
I measure the time it takes for a loco to travel the length of a long straight, which is 26.4 inches (670mm). I then use my simple chart to estimate the speed.
Mind you for more accurate speeds measure the time over a longer distance.
These speeds I verified against other online ones. My chart goes up to 200mph, only because one of my little cheap shunters does around 180mph scale speed.
